Taylor Hawkins and the Coattail Riders – ‘Red Light Fever’
Like Chickenfoot and Them Crooked Vultures, Foo Fighters drummer Taylor Hawkins’ second outing with the Coattail Riders is another perfectly solid and solidly entertaining foray into pedigreed, classic 1970s AOR territory. Red Light Fever finds Hawkins fronting what sounds like the hardest working L.A. bar band of the highest caliber.

Foo Fighters Confirm Tracklisting For Greatest Hits LP
Foo Fighters have just revealed the tracklisting for their upcoming retrospective hits collection due on November 3rd via via Roswell/RCA. As reported previously, Foo Fighters Greatest Hits will feature two new songs (“Wheels” and “Word Forward” along with the band’s most popular hits over its 15-year, multiplatinum career such as “Big Me,” “Everlong” (studio and acoustic versions), “My Hero” and “Times Like These.”
